Despite an all out campaign by the Obama administration and Congressional Democrats to convince voters that ‘D’ is for ‘drive’ and ‘R’ is for reverse, voters none-the-less now trust the Pachyderms more than the Jackasses on all 10 top issues, according to a new Rasmussen poll.
| Issue | Democrats | Republicans |
|---|---|---|
| Education | 40% | 41% |
| Health Care | 40% | 48% |
| Iraq | 40% | 43% |
| Economy | 39% | 47% |
| Social Security | 38% | 44% |
| Government Ethics | 38% | 40% |
| National Security | 37% | 49% |
| Afghanistan | 36% | 43% |
| Taxes | 36% | 52% |
| Immigration | 35% | 44% |
The most interesting part of this poll is the results for the issue of ‘government ethics’. Democrats won in large measure by painting Republicans as hopelessly corrupt. Obama ran on the promise to “clean up Washington” and Speaker Pelosi pledged that her Congress would be “the most ethical Congress in history.” Even though Rassmussen reports that “more than one-in-five voters (22%) are still not sure which party to trust more on ethics issues”, the Republicans are edging out the Dems on that issue.
